What it does
This rolls up the week's reconciliation findings into a single reviewable audit. It reads every flagged proration discrepancy from your Snowflake reconciliation table, classifies them by size and direction (owed-to-customer vs revenue-leakage), checks counts against your anomaly thresholds, and builds a Notion page finance can read in two minutes: net dollar exposure, top accounts, and any credit memos still unresolved.
When to use it
Use it for a recurring finance close ritual or board-prep where someone needs the proration health of the book at a glance, not a raw query export. The threshold check also surfaces weeks where mischarge volume spikes, which usually signals a pricing-config or webhook regression worth investigating.
